AWS VPS 修改mac地址导致无法连接

本文最后更新于(2023-1-10 09:44:34),链接可能失效,内容可能难以复现。请注意甄别。
© Sunplace,2018

起因

安装在VPS上的TeamViewer显示试用已过期,网上说是用了商业版,需要切换成个人版。操作就是修改Mac地址…… 下载修改地址的软件,修改成功重启之后就再也连不上了。 好了,我知道我修改成功了。 [disdain]

以下是AWS EC2的免费1年套餐t2.micro(Windows Server 2008 r2)上的救灾步骤:

  1. 登陆EC2 Management Console
  2. 创建网络接口:网络与安全-网络接口。此套餐支持最多2张网卡,新的网卡的安全组要和旧网卡的安全组一致。https://docs.aws.amazon.com/zh_cn/AWSEC2/latest/WindowsGuide/using-eni.html#create_eni
  3. 创建弹性IP:网络与安全-弹性IP。使用Amazon的地址池,绑定网卡的弹性IP不收费。https://docs.aws.amazon.com/zh_cn/AWSEC2/latest/WindowsGuide/elastic-ip-addresses-eip.html
  4. 将之前创建的新网卡关联到这个弹性IP地址:网络与安全-网络接口。
  5. 使用弹性IP地址来远程桌面。
  6. 找到网络连接-属性-配置-高级,在左边有个“没有描述”,它的值就是修改后的Mac地址。因为旧网卡一般是AWS PV Network Device #0,把这个值复制下来,到注册表查找,找到对应位置为HKEY_LOCAL_MACHINES\SYSTEM\CurrentControlSet\Control\Class\{4D36E972-E325-11CE-BFC1-08002BE10318}\0013确定键名NetworkAddress的值一致后,删除该键。
  7. 重启VPC。
  8. 使用最初的公网IP测试是否能恢复链接。
  9. *解除弹性IP关联。
  10. *删除网络接口。
  11. *释放弹性IP。
  12. 创建快照:ELASTIC BLOCK STORE – 快照。付费项目:$0.05 per GB-Month of snapshot data stored – US East (Ohio)
* 可以保留,但弹性IP如果闲置就会收费。https://console.aws.amazon.com/billing/ 一定要记得创建快照啊! [spit] [spit]